Childhood Vitiligo: Causes, Treatment and Latest Advances

Jul 27, 2026

Finding a pale or white patch on your child’s skin can be worrying, particularly if you are unsure why it has appeared or whether it will spread. Vitiligo is one possible cause and can begin during childhood or adolescence.

Vitiligo causes areas of skin to lose their natural pigment, but it is not contagious and is not caused by poor hygiene, diet or anything you have done. Treatment may help restore some colour, control active disease and support your child’s confidence and wellbeing.

What Is Childhood Vitiligo?

Vitiligo develops when pigment-producing cells called melanocytes stop working or are destroyed, causing lighter or white patches on your child’s skin. The patches can affect one small area or several parts of the body.

Some children develop new patches gradually, while others experience periods of activity followed by long periods of stability. Vitiligo can affect children of every skin tone, although the contrast may be more noticeable on darker skin.

Why Does Vitiligo Develop?

There is no single known cause of vitiligo. Non-segmental vitiligo is generally considered an autoimmune condition in which your child’s immune system mistakenly targets melanocytes.

Genetics, immune-system changes and environmental factors may all contribute to the condition developing. A family history can increase susceptibility, but many children with vitiligo have no known affected relatives.

What Can Vitiligo Look Like in Children?

You may notice flat areas of your child’s skin that are lighter than the surrounding skin and may gradually become completely white. The patches usually have clearly defined borders and typically remain smooth rather than becoming rough or scaly.

Common areas include the face, hands, fingers, elbows, knees, feet and skin around the eyes or mouth. Hair growing within an affected patch can sometimes turn white, including scalp hair, eyebrows or eyelashes.

What Early Signs Might You Notice?

You may first notice a small pale patch that becomes more obvious during summer when the surrounding skin tans. Early changes can appear around your child’s fingertips, eyelids, mouth or areas exposed to frequent rubbing.

Vitiligo usually does not cause pain, although mild itching can occur in some children. Taking occasional photographs in similar lighting can help you monitor changes without checking your child’s skin excessively.

How Can Non-Segmental Vitiligo Affect Your Child?

Non-segmental vitiligo is the most common form and often affects both sides of your child’s body. You may notice patches around both eyes, on both knees, across several fingers or in other areas, although the pattern is not always perfectly symmetrical.

New patches can sometimes appear after a period of stability, and this form can be associated with other autoimmune conditions such as thyroid disease. Your healthcare professional may therefore ask about your child’s general health and family medical history.

What Is Segmental Vitiligo?

Segmental vitiligo usually affects one side or one localised area of your child’s body and often begins at a younger age. You may notice patches on the face, trunk or one limb.

The condition often spreads for a limited period before becoming stable. If hair within the affected area turns white, repigmentation may be more difficult because hair follicles can play an important role in restoring pigment.

Why Can Skin Injuries Trigger New Patches?

You may notice new vitiligo patches appearing where your child has experienced a cut, graze, burn or repeated friction. This response is known as the Koebner phenomenon.

Your child can still play, exercise and take part in normal activities. You can reduce unnecessary irritation by preventing sunburn, treating itchy skin promptly and ensuring clothing or sports equipment does not repeatedly rub the same areas.

What Other Conditions Can Look Like Vitiligo?

Not every pale patch on your child’s skin is caused by vitiligo. Conditions such as pityriasis alba, pityriasis versicolor, eczema-related pigment change, scars and other skin conditions can create lighter areas.

A dermatologist can look at the colour, texture and pattern of your child’s patches to help identify the cause. You should arrange an assessment if the patches are spreading, changing or associated with scaling, discomfort or altered skin texture.

How Is Childhood Vitiligo Diagnosed?

Vitiligo is usually diagnosed by examining your child’s skin and reviewing their medical history. The clinician will consider the colour, borders, distribution and texture of the patches and ask how they have changed.

A Wood’s lamp may be used to make pigment loss easier to see and help distinguish vitiligo from other causes of lighter skin. A skin biopsy is rarely required unless the diagnosis remains uncertain.

Might Your Child Need Blood Tests?

Children with non-segmental vitiligo have an increased likelihood of some autoimmune conditions, particularly thyroid disease. This does not mean your child will necessarily develop another autoimmune condition.

British Association of Dermatologists guidance recommends thyroid-function and antithyroid-antibody screening for people with vitiligo, including children when appropriate for their age. Your child’s healthcare professional will decide which tests are appropriate based on symptoms, medical history and family history.

Is Your Child’s Vitiligo Active or Stable?

Active vitiligo means that new patches are appearing or existing areas are becoming larger. Stable vitiligo means your child has had no significant new patches or progression for a period of time.

Photographs and follow-up examinations can help the dermatologist understand whether the condition is changing. Knowing whether your child’s vitiligo is active or stable can influence which treatments are most appropriate.

How Can Vitiligo Affect Your Child Emotionally?

Vitiligo usually does not make your child physically unwell, but visible skin changes can affect confidence and emotional wellbeing. You may notice self-consciousness, worry about questions from other people or reluctance to take part in certain activities.

The emotional impact is not always related to how much skin is affected. Even a small visible patch can be important to your child, so it helps to ask how they feel rather than assuming they are coping well.

How Should You Protect Your Child’s Skin From the Sun?

Vitiligo patches contain little or no melanin, so your child’s affected skin can burn more easily. Use a broad-spectrum SPF 50 or higher sunscreen with good UVA protection on exposed areas.

Reapply sunscreen regularly, particularly after swimming, towel-drying or heavy sweating, and use clothing, hats and shade for additional protection. You can also ask your child’s GP or dermatologist whether vitamin D advice or an age-appropriate supplement is needed.

Does Every Child With Vitiligo Need Treatment?

Not every child needs treatment aimed at restoring pigment. You may prefer monitoring, sun protection and emotional support if your child has limited stable patches and feels comfortable with their appearance.

Treatment may be considered when vitiligo is active, spreading or affecting your child’s confidence and quality of life. Their clinician will consider age, skin tone, disease pattern and how practical the treatment routine will be for your family.

How Can Topical Corticosteroids Help?

Topical corticosteroids can be used for selected small areas of active vitiligo by reducing immune activity in your child’s skin. The strength and duration of treatment depend on age and the area being treated.

More delicate areas such as the face, eyelids and skin folds may require different treatments because they are more vulnerable to steroid side effects. You should follow the prescribed amount and schedule carefully to reduce the risk of skin thinning.

Could Tacrolimus or Pimecrolimus Be Suitable?

Tacrolimus ointment and pimecrolimus cream reduce immune activity without causing the skin thinning associated with topical steroids. They can therefore be useful on delicate areas such as your child’s face, eyelids, neck or skin folds.

Your child may initially notice mild warmth, stinging or burning when treatment is applied. Repigmentation can develop gradually, although areas such as the fingers, toes or patches containing white hair may respond less completely.

When Might Your Child Need Narrowband UVB Phototherapy?

Narrowband UVB phototherapy may be considered when your child’s vitiligo is widespread, actively spreading or significantly affecting quality of life. Treatment uses carefully controlled ultraviolet B light under specialist dermatology supervision.

Appointments are often required two or three times each week for several months, so the practical commitment should be discussed before treatment begins. Repigmentation often responds better on the face and trunk than on the hands and feet, although results vary.

Ruxolitinib Cream: What Should You Know?

Ruxolitinib cream is a topical Janus kinase inhibitor that targets immune signalling involved in non-segmental vitiligo. It is licensed for people aged 12 years and over with non-segmental vitiligo involving the face.

Your dermatologist may consider it when your child is eligible and first-line topical treatments have not worked or are unsuitable. Treatment requires specialist supervision and may need to continue for several months before meaningful repigmentation becomes visible.

UK Guidance Note

NICE recommends ruxolitinib cream as an option for people aged 12 years and over with non-segmental vitiligo involving the face when first-line topical treatments have not worked or cannot be used. It should be started and supervised by an appropriately experienced clinician.

Its safety and effectiveness have not been established for children under 12. Your dermatologist can explain whether your child meets the treatment criteria and what monitoring may be needed.

What Other Vitiligo Treatments Are Being Studied?

Researchers are continuing to investigate treatments that target the immune processes involved in vitiligo more precisely. Your dermatologist may also discuss targeted light treatment for selected small or localised patches.

Surgical techniques that transfer pigment-producing cells are generally reserved for carefully selected stable disease and are not routinely used in children. Many newer approaches still require stronger evidence about their long-term safety and effectiveness.

Frequently Asked Questions

1. What causes vitiligo in children?
Non-segmental vitiligo is generally considered an autoimmune condition in which your child’s immune system targets pigment-producing melanocytes. Genetics, immune changes and environmental factors may contribute, but it is not caused by poor hygiene, ordinary foods or anything you have done.

2. Is childhood vitiligo contagious?
No. Your child cannot pass vitiligo to another person through touching, hugging, swimming, sharing towels or attending school because the condition is not caused by an infection.

3. Can vitiligo spread over time?
Yes, some children develop new patches over time, while others have one or two areas that remain stable for years. Your child may experience periods of activity followed by long periods when the condition does not noticeably change.

4. How is childhood vitiligo diagnosed?
Your child’s dermatologist will usually diagnose vitiligo by examining the skin and reviewing their medical and family history. A Wood’s lamp may help show pigment loss more clearly, while blood tests may be used to investigate associated autoimmune conditions rather than confirm vitiligo itself.

5. Can vitiligo be cured?
There is currently no guaranteed cure for vitiligo. Treatment may help your child regain some pigment, control active disease or reduce contrast between affected and unaffected skin, but results vary.

6. What treatments are available for childhood vitiligo?
Your child’s treatment may include topical corticosteroids, tacrolimus, pimecrolimus or narrowband UVB phototherapy. Eligible young people aged 12 years and over with non-segmental facial vitiligo may also be considered for ruxolitinib cream.

7. Does vitiligo affect your child’s overall health?

Vitiligo itself usually does not make your child physically unwell, but it can be associated with certain autoimmune conditions, particularly thyroid disease. Your child’s healthcare professional can advise whether thyroid screening or other investigations are appropriate.

8. Can sunlight make vitiligo worse?
Vitiligo patches have little or no melanin and can therefore burn more easily. You can protect your child’s skin with high-factor sunscreen, suitable clothing and shade while avoiding sunburn.

9. How can you support your child emotionally?
You can help by listening to your child’s concerns and reassuring them that vitiligo is not their fault or something they can pass to others. Addressing teasing early and involving teachers when appropriate can also protect confidence and emotional wellbeing.

10. What is the outlook for children with vitiligo?
The course varies from one child to another, with some patches remaining stable and others changing over time. Treatment and follow-up may help your child manage active disease, encourage repigmentation and maintain a good quality of life.
